Ultramarine is the most common blue inorganic pigment. It is compound with sulfur of aluminum silicate, having vivid lustre and pure colour.
Molecular formula
Na6Al4Si6S4O20
Characteristic
* Excellent Thermostability
* Excellent Light Fastness
* Untransferable
* Easy to Scatter
* Safe and Poisonless
Scope of Application:
* Tinting: Applied to Paint, Ink, Spray, Rubber, Plastic, Arts pigment, Cosmetics, etc. And MAINLY APPLIED TO INDUSTRIES OF ARCHITECTURAL COATING, PLASTIC, RUBBER, PAINT AND SO ON
* Whitening: Ultramarine can remove yellow colour contained in white materials.
* Mix colours: Ultramarine can make black or grey have soft lustre.
